Using the distributive property to find the product (y – 4)(y2 + 4y + 16) results in a polynomial of the form y3 + 4y2 + ay – 4y
Travka [436]
( y - 4 ) ( y² + 4 y + 16 ) =
= y³ + 4 y² + 16 y - 4 y² - 16 y - 64 = y³ - 64
If the result is the polynomial of the form:
y³ + 4 y² + a y - 4 y² - a y - 64
a = 16

What characteristics lead to a downward sloping demand curve?
Makovka662 [10]
In economics, the downward sloping demand curve is used to illustrate the law of diminishing marginal utility. This means that if more of the product is consumed, the marginal benefit to the consumer falls. This is also the instance in which the consumers are willing to pay less than the original amount for the same product.

Suppose y varies directly with x, and y = 8 when x = –6. What direct variation equation relates x and y? What is the value of y
Agata [3.3K]
Given:
y varies directly with x
y = 8 when x = -6

what is the value of y when x = -2?

y = kx

we need to get the constant of variation.
8 = k(-6)
8/-6 = k
4/-3 = k or - 1 1/3

y = -4/3 (-2)
y = (-4*-2) / 3
y = 8 / 3
y = 2 2/3 OR 2.67

The correct answer is Choice B. y = -1.33x ; 2.67
